Given that your roof is consistently subjected to the outside elements, this means your roof is going to break down gradually. The pace at which it breaks down will be dependent on a range of factors. Those include; the grade of the initial materials that were used and the workmanship, the level of abuse it will have to take from the elements, how well the roof is taken care of and the design of the roof. Most roofing contractors will estimate around 20 years for a well-built and well-maintained roof, but that can never be promised due to the above factors. Our advice is to always keep your roof well maintained and get regular checkups to make sure it lasts as long as possible.
You should not ever pressure-wash your roof, as you run the risk of removing any covering materials that have been added to provide protection from the elements. Aside from that, you really should stay clear of chlorine-based bleach cleaning products as they may also reduce the lifespan of your roof. When you speak with your roof cleaning expert, ask them to use an EPA-approved algaecide/fungicide to clean your roof. This will clear away the undesirable algae and discoloration without ruining the tile or shingles.

More About Spring Hill
Spring Hill is a census-designated place (CDP) in Hernando County, Florida, United States. The population was 98,621 at the 2010 census,[1] up from 69,078 at the 2000 census. The American Community Survey estimated the population in 2017 to be 113,508.[4] Spring Hill belongs to Florida’s Nature Coast region and is in the Tampa-St. Petersburg-Clearwater metro area. It is east of Hernando Beach, southwest of Brooksville, and north of Tampa.
Spring Hill was formerly a large tract of endangered Longleaf Pine Ecosystem and Sand Pine Scrub with very high biodiversity, and a safe haven for many imperiled species, and most of it remained unchanged until the 1970’s with large scale deforestation.[citation needed] It first appeared on Hernando County maps as early as 1856 along what is today Fort Dade Avenue just north of the community of Wiscon.[5] The modern Spring Hill was founded in 1967 as a planned community, which was developed by the Deltona Corporation and the Mackle Brothers. The developers originally wanted to call the community Spring Lake and used that as the working name through the development process. They were forced to use a different name due to the name Spring Lake already being in use locally and chose Spring Hill.[6] The plans for the community are identical to the community of Deltona. The Mackle Brothers sold many of the properties and land in the area through intense advertising.[7] It has since become a sprawling semi-city in its own right, though it is an unincorporated area. The main entrance to the original development is marked by the Spring Hill waterfall on Spring Hill Drive and U.S. Route 19 (Commercial Way).
How To Choose A Reliable Roofing Contractor For Your Home
The main reason for the roof is usually to shelter your family and friends through the rain, wind, snow, and harsh summer sun. Having a well-maintained roof is vital if you would like develop a home that is certainly safe and comfy.Unfortunately, roofing materials don’t last forever. All roofs have to be repaired or replaced at some point or another. Unless you will find the right tools and experience to accomplish the task yourself, that typically means hiring a professional roofing company.
The significance of hiring the right company can’t be overstated. Most roofing projects are quite expensive. You have to know that you are investing your hard earned money wisely which the finished roof may last for many years to come. Check out these tips about how to get a reliable roof specialist for your home:
1. Utilize a local company. Prior to hiring a contractor, make certain that there is a physical address within your city or county. Local contractors will probably know about the codes and building requirements in your neighborhood. Also, they are less likely to try to scam you away from your money since they should maintain their reputation in your community.
2. Verify the contractor is licensed and insured. Reputable contractors always make time to get licensed. You will be able to lookup licensing information online throughout the website of your city or state. Check to make certain that the contractor’s license applies and that it is current prior to hiring them. Additionally, ask the contractor to offer evidence of liability insurance and worker’s compensation insurance before they start work.
3. Solicit competing quotes. Don’t make the mistake of hiring the initial company that you simply contact. Instead, get in touch with at least various contractors in your neighborhood to get quotes for your roofing project. Ask each contractor to present you an itemized quote to be able to see precisely where your hard earned money is going. Ideally, they need to send a representative to your property to examine your homes roof personally before offering you an insurance quote. Like that, the estimate they offer will be a lot more accurate.
4. Be sure the clients are trustworthy by reading through reviews from the past clients. Consider checking with groups just like the Better Business Bureau (BBB) to ensure that no major complaints have been filed against them.
5. Get everything in writing. Don’t simply take a contractor at their word. Instead, ask them to offer you a written contract. Be sure both you and also the contractor sign the contract. Have a copy for yourself in case any problems or disputes arise. A signed contract reduces the chance of misunderstandings and offers you legal protection in the event the contractor fails to adhere to through on the promises.
Deciding on a reliable roofing contractor for your residence is really important. The roof is probably the most critical components of your property. Employing a professional roofer having a great reputation is the best way to ensure that the project goes as planned.
